*Biden: I’ ll President for all Americans, there ‘ll be no Blue or Red States…

Joseph R. Biden Jr. has been elected as 46th president of the United States with 284 electoral votes, defeating President Donald Trump in a bitterly contested poll.

Biden, 78, will become the oldest man ever sworn into the office after winning the much contested Pennsylvania.

On Saturday, four days after Election Day, he secured the requisite 270 votes from the Electoral College.

The election, far closer than many experts had predicted, was history-making.

Biden’s running mate, Senator Kamala Harris of California, is the first woman, and the first woman of color, on a winning presidential ticket.

Meanwhile, Biden has spoken, saying he would president for all Americans regardless of political persuasion.

Biden reiterates that under his presidency, there would be neither blue states nor red states, stressing that there would be one united states of America.
